Choosing a Citizenship by Investment Agent: Key Considerations

Selecting a qualified Citizenship by Investment firm is a essential step in the process towards receiving a second citizenship . Thoroughly evaluate several aspects before making your Citizenship by Investment Agent choice . To begin with, ensure the firm's registration with relevant authorities . Moreover , research their history and standing within the sector . It is necessary to recognize the breadth of assistance they deliver and their costs, and to request testimonials from former customers . Finally, ensure transparency regarding every components of the program and the associated conditions .
